OmicsView
OmicsView provides interactive visualization and analysis of NGS-derived expression omics datasets to enable exploration of transcriptional profiles across human tissues and diseases, including GTEx data.
Key Features:
- Comprehensive Data Integration: Preloaded with thousands of samples spanning numerous disease areas and normal tissue types, including the GTEx database.
- Harmonized Processing: All integrated datasets are processed using a harmonized pipeline to ensure consistency and reliability.
- Analytical Capabilities: Supports a wide range of analytical tasks for understanding disease pathology, identifying biomarkers, and evaluating the effects of interventions in vivo and in vitro, enabling rapid data mining of transcriptional signatures.
- Disease Case Study: Applied to Crohn’s disease datasets to identify key aspects of pathology, robust biomarkers, and markers indicative of treatment response.
Scientific Applications:
- Disease Pathology Exploration: Enables detailed analysis of gene expression profiles to elucidate molecular underpinnings of diseases.
- Biomarker Discovery: Supports identification of biomarkers for diagnosis, prognosis, and monitoring therapeutic responses.
- Interventional Studies: Facilitates assessment of intervention impacts on gene expression patterns in both in vivo and in vitro settings.
Methodology:
Integrated datasets, including NGS-derived expression data and GTEx, are processed using a harmonized pipeline.
